Fyi, GPIO 121 is muxed to gptimer11 PWM event. Kuzma30 and crew are still tweaking the backlight driver to work correctly, but its using PWM.

New problem found
1. NT reboot only when USB cable is connected (I always work with uSB cable connected and don't found this bug previosly)
UART log after choose reboot menu in ICS.
Code:
kxtf9: kxtf9_irq_work_func ...
kxtf9 1-000f: IRQ TAP2 [2]
MAX17042 shutdown function
max17042: max17042_disable ...
PVR: PVRSRVDriverShutdown(pDevice=ed4ab600)
PVR: SysSystemPrePowerState: Entering state D3
PVR: Uninstalling device LISR on IRQ 53 with cookie ece22700
PVR: DisableSystemClocks: Disabling System Clocks
 boxer : boxer_panel_disable called , line 346
 boxer : boxer_panel_stop called , line 310
Backlight set power, on_off = 0
Backlight set power end
NookTablet LCD disable!
Fixed voltage disable GPIO = 121
omap_hsmmc omap_hsmmc.2: shutting down mmc
omap_hsmmc omap_hsmmc.0: shutting down mmc
omap_hsmmc omap_hsmmc.1: shutting down mmc
Restarting system with command ' '.

Restarting Linux version 3.0.21+ (nook@localhost) (gcc version 4.4.1 (Sourcery G++ Lite 2010q1-202) ) #351 SMP PREEMPT Sun Ma2



Texas Instruments X-Loader 1.41 (Oct 21 2011 - 14:00:05)
Checking power button state... RELEASED. NOK.
Powering off!
2. External SD card don't recognized after software reboot. Emmc and WiFi are working.

2. External SD card don't recognized after software reboot. Emmc and WiFi are working.
This is an issue with cm7 as well. I believe it is caused by hardware limitations. If you do a software reboot, the ext SD will not be recognized unless you pop it out and reinsert it. This occurs both within cm7 and cwm recovery.

A full shutdown and power up does not cause the issue.
